Abstract

Interest to study neutrons produced in Extensive Air Showers (EAS) is rising last years. History and recent publications on this subject are overviewed and estimated. Advantages of the method to study hadronic component being the main EAS component, as well as perspectives of the method are shown using ENDA-LHAASO project as an example.
